当前位置: 首页 > 手机窍门>正文

手机怎么开发网站-手机开发网站

在当今数字化时代,手机已成为人们日常生活中不可或缺的工具。
随着移动互联网的迅猛发展,手机用户对在线服务的需求日益增长,推动了手机应用与网站开发的深度融合。手机开发网站不仅需要具备良好的用户体验,还必须满足高性能、快速加载和多平台兼容性等要求。
也是因为这些,手机开发网站的构建成为企业和开发者关注的焦点。本文将从技术实现、开发流程、用户体验优化等方面,详细阐述如何在手机上开发网站,确保其在移动环境下的稳定运行和高效交互。
一、手机网站开发的基本原理与技术框架 手机网站开发主要依赖于Web技术,包括HTML、CSS、JavaScript以及前端框架如React、Vue.js等。这些技术共同构成了网页的结构、样式和交互功能。在手机端,网页需要适应不同屏幕尺寸和分辨率,因此响应式设计是必不可少的。响应式设计通过媒体查询(media queries)和弹性布局(flexible layout)实现内容的自适应,使网站在不同设备上都能呈现出良好的视觉效果。 除了这些之外呢,为了提升网站的加载速度,开发者通常会采用内容分发网络(CDN)和优化图片格式(如WebP)等技术。CDN可以将网站资源缓存到全球多个节点,减少用户访问时的延迟,提高加载效率。
于此同时呢,压缩图片和代码,减少HTTP请求,也是优化性能的重要手段。
二、开发流程与关键技术 手机网站的开发流程通常包括需求分析、设计、开发、测试和部署五个阶段。在需求分析阶段,开发者需要明确用户需求和功能目标,确保网站能够满足用户的实际使用场景。设计阶段则需要考虑响应式布局、交互设计和用户体验优化。 在开发阶段,前端开发人员负责实现网页的结构和样式,后端开发人员则负责处理数据和逻辑。两者需要紧密协作,确保功能的完整性和性能的高效性。
例如,使用JavaScript实现动态交互,如表单验证、数据实时更新等,可以显著提升用户的操作体验。 在测试阶段,开发者需要进行多设备和浏览器的兼容性测试,确保网站在不同操作系统和浏览器上都能正常运行。
除了这些以外呢,安全性也是不可忽视的问题,开发者需要防范XSS(跨站脚本攻击)和CSRF(跨站请求伪造)等安全漏洞,保障用户数据的安全。
三、用户体验优化与交互设计 用户体验(UX)是手机网站开发的核心。良好的用户体验不仅包括界面美观,还涉及操作的便捷性和信息的清晰传达。为了提升用户体验,开发者需要关注以下几个方面:
1.导航设计:网站的导航菜单应简洁明了,用户能够快速找到所需信息。对于移动端,通常采用底部导航栏或侧边栏,确保用户在不同页面之间切换流畅。
2.交互反馈:用户在操作过程中,如点击按钮、滑动页面等,应获得明确的反馈,例如按钮的点击效果、页面的加载动画等,以增强用户的操作感知。
3.响应式设计:网站应具备良好的自适应能力,确保在不同屏幕尺寸下都能提供良好的视觉体验。
例如,移动端的按钮应适当增大,文字应适配不同字体大小,避免信息过载。
4.加载速度优化:网站的加载速度直接影响用户体验,因此需要优化图片、代码和资源的加载方式。
例如,使用懒加载技术,只在用户滚动到页面时加载相关图片,减少初始加载时间。
四、多平台兼容性与性能优化 手机网站开发不仅要考虑移动端,还需考虑其他平台,如桌面端、平板端等。不同平台的屏幕尺寸、分辨率和操作系统版本可能不同,因此需要确保网站在不同设备上都能正常运行。 为了提升性能,开发者可以采用以下技术:
1.渐进式Web应用(PWA):PWA是一种基于Web技术的移动应用,可以利用HTTPS、Service Workers等技术实现离线访问和推送通知,提升用户体验。
2.WebAssembly(Wasm):WebAssembly是一种新型的编程语言,可以在浏览器中运行高性能的代码,适用于需要复杂计算或图形处理的场景。
3.性能监控工具:使用性能分析工具,如Chrome DevTools,可以实时监测网站的加载速度、内存使用情况和资源消耗,帮助开发者优化性能。
五、安全与隐私保护 随着用户数据的不断积累,网站的安全性和隐私保护成为开发者必须重视的问题。手机网站在开发过程中需要采取以下措施:
1.数据加密:用户数据在传输和存储过程中应采用加密技术,如HTTPS、SSL/TLS,确保数据在传输过程中不被窃取。
2.权限控制:网站应设置严格的权限管理,限制用户对敏感信息的访问权限,避免数据泄露。
3.隐私政策:网站应明确告知用户数据的收集和使用方式,并提供隐私政策链接,让用户了解自己的权利。
4.安全审计:定期进行安全审计,检查是否存在漏洞,如SQL注入、XSS攻击等,确保网站的安全性。
六、开发工具与资源支持 开发手机网站可以借助多种工具和资源,提高开发效率和质量:
1.开发工具:使用WebStorm、VS Code、Adobe XD等工具,可以提升开发效率,支持代码编辑、调试和测试功能。
2.框架与库:使用React、Vue.js、Angular等前端框架,可以快速构建复杂的用户界面,提升开发效率。
3.云服务:使用AWS、阿里云等云服务,可以实现网站的部署和托管,提高网站的可用性和扩展性。
4.测试工具:使用Selenium、Jest、Postman等工具,可以进行自动化测试,确保网站在不同环境下的稳定性。
七、在以后发展趋势与挑战 随着技术的不断进步,手机网站开发正朝着更加智能化、个性化和高效化的方向发展。在以后的趋势包括:
1.AI与机器学习:AI技术可以用于个性化推荐、智能客服等,提升用户体验。
2.增强现实(AR)与虚拟现实(VR):AR和VR技术可以为用户提供更加沉浸式的体验,适用于电商、教育等领域。
3.5G网络普及:5G网络的高速度和低延迟,将为手机网站提供更流畅的体验,推动更多在线服务的发展。 开发手机网站也面临诸多挑战,如跨平台兼容性、性能优化、安全问题等,需要开发者不断学习和适应新技术,以应对不断变化的市场需求。
八、归结起来说 手机网站开发是一个复杂而综合的过程,涉及技术、设计、测试和优化等多个方面。开发者需要具备良好的技术能力,同时注重用户体验和性能优化,以满足用户的需求。
随着技术的不断进步,手机网站开发将更加智能化和高效化,为用户提供更加优质的在线服务。在在以后的竞争中,只有不断创新和优化,才能在移动互联网时代立于不败之地。
版权声明

1本文地址:手机怎么开发网站-手机开发网站转载请注明出处。
2本站内容除财经网签约编辑原创以外,部分来源网络由互联网用户自发投稿仅供学习参考。
3文章观点仅代表原作者本人不代表本站立场,并不完全代表本站赞同其观点和对其真实性负责。
4文章版权归原作者所有,部分转载文章仅为传播更多信息服务用户,如信息标记有误请联系管理员。
5 本站一律禁止以任何方式发布或转载任何违法违规的相关信息,如发现本站上有涉嫌侵权/违规及任何不妥的内容,请第一时间联系我们 申诉反馈,经核实立即修正或删除。


本站仅提供信息存储空间服务,部分内容不拥有所有权,不承担相关法律责任。

相关文章:

  • 妙笔生花成语-妙笔生花成语改写为:妙笔生花 2025-11-04 10:09:13
  • 欣喜若狂的近义词-欣喜若狂的近义词:狂喜、欢欣、欣喜 2025-11-04 10:09:59
  • 天气谚语-天气谚语简写 2025-11-04 10:10:27
  • 珍贵近义词反义词-珍贵近义词反义词 2025-11-04 10:12:17
  • 谐音歇后语-谐音歇后语 2025-11-04 10:12:52
  • 即使也造句-即使也造句 2025-11-04 10:14:17
  • qq邮箱格式怎么写-qq邮箱格式示例 2025-11-04 10:15:38
  • 关于草的成语及解释-草木成语 2025-11-04 10:16:31
  • 浩瀚的近义词-浩瀚之境 2025-11-04 10:17:09
  • 气象谚语-气象谚语 2025-11-04 10:17:44